I've done some googling on the subject and I am interested to hear some CGN opinions on these questions.
1. At what round count do you high volume shooters start looking towards changing out their barrels? I've heard as low at 3k for match shooters and some as high as 25k.
2. How much of a factor does heat play into barrel wear in a semi-auto platform?
I noticed yesterday between shooting some MFS steel case and a bunch of norinco that my barrel and hand guard was way hotter than I had experienced before. After about 300 rounds of fairly quick succession mags I finally took a break long enough to watch the smoke coming out of the hand guard vents and figured that it was time for a long cool down, nearly 20 minutes later and it was cooled down enough to think about putting it in the case.
